MySQL如何開啟用戶遠(yuǎn)程登錄權(quán)限
MySQL開啟用戶遠(yuǎn)程登錄權(quán)限
當(dāng)在Docker中創(chuàng)建一個(gè)Mysql的容器后,需要使用工具如:navicate來連接容器內(nèi)的MySQL服務(wù),但是
提示Access denied for user 'root'@ 'x.x.x.x' (using password: YES) 錯(cuò)誤,用命令進(jìn)入容器確認(rèn)密碼沒有問題,那么就可能是沒有開發(fā)遠(yuǎn)程權(quán)限。
第一步:選中mysql數(shù)據(jù)庫(kù)
use mysql;
第二步:修改庫(kù)中user表中,user用戶的host=%(任意連接)
update user set host='%' where user ='root';
第三步:重新加載權(quán)限表
flush privileges;
第四步:給root用戶賦予遠(yuǎn)程連接權(quán)限
grant all privileges on *.* to 'root'@'%' with grant option; # 賦予權(quán)限并修改密碼 alter user 'root'@'%' identified with mysql_native_password by '123456';
開放MySQL的遠(yuǎn)程訪問權(quán)限
1.使用 mysql -u root -p 連接到本地MySQL服務(wù)
2.登錄后使用 use mysql;
3.使用 grant all privileges on . to ‘root’@‘%’ identified by ‘123456’ with grant option; 賦予遠(yuǎn)程登錄用戶權(quán)限(使用root賬號(hào)和密碼123456,從任何主機(jī)連接到mysql服務(wù)器),刷新權(quán)限 FLUSH PRIVILEGES;
4.使用 select user,host from user 查看系統(tǒng)用戶
5.使用 vim /etc/mysql/mysql.conf.d/mysqld.cnf 修改bind-address的訪問網(wǎng)址,將 bind-address=127.0.0.1 改成 bind-address=0.0.0.0
6.開放端口 3306(這是MySQL的默認(rèn)端口)
總結(jié)
以上為個(gè)人經(jīng)驗(yàn),希望能給大家一個(gè)參考,也希望大家多多支持腳本之家。
- MySQL數(shù)據(jù)庫(kù)用戶權(quán)限管理
- MySQL用戶和數(shù)據(jù)權(quán)限管理詳解
- MySQL權(quán)限控制和用戶與角色管理實(shí)例分析講解
- Navicat配置mysql數(shù)據(jù)庫(kù)用戶權(quán)限問題
- MySQL設(shè)置用戶權(quán)限的簡(jiǎn)單步驟
- Mysql用戶創(chuàng)建以及權(quán)限賦予操作的實(shí)現(xiàn)
- MySQL授予用戶權(quán)限命令詳解
- Mysql用戶權(quán)限分配實(shí)戰(zhàn)項(xiàng)目詳解
- mysql 添加用戶并分配select權(quán)限的實(shí)現(xiàn)
相關(guān)文章
10個(gè)MySQL性能調(diào)優(yōu)的方法
本文介紹了10個(gè)MySQL性能調(diào)優(yōu)的方法,每個(gè)方法的講解都很細(xì)致,非常實(shí)用,,需要的朋友可以參考下2015-07-07MySQL數(shù)據(jù)庫(kù)使用規(guī)范總結(jié)
本篇文章給大家詳細(xì)分類總結(jié)了數(shù)據(jù)庫(kù)相關(guān)規(guī)范,幫助大家發(fā)揮出數(shù)據(jù)庫(kù)的性能,感興趣的朋友可以了解下2020-08-08MySQL 的 21 個(gè)規(guī)范、優(yōu)化最佳實(shí)踐!
每一個(gè)好習(xí)慣都是一筆財(cái)富,本文分 SQL 后悔藥,SQL 性能優(yōu)化,SQL 規(guī)范優(yōu)雅三個(gè)方向,分享寫 SQL 的 21 個(gè)好習(xí)慣和最佳實(shí)踐2020-12-12windows10下mysql 8.0 下載與安裝配置圖文教程
這篇文章主要介紹了windows10下mysql 8.0 下載與安裝配置圖文教程,具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2019-02-02Mysql復(fù)合主鍵和聯(lián)合主鍵的區(qū)別解析
這篇文章主要介紹了Mysql復(fù)合主鍵和聯(lián)合主鍵的區(qū)別,本文通過實(shí)例代碼給大家介紹的非常詳細(xì),對(duì)大家的學(xué)習(xí)或工作具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2023-04-04